Analytical method, which can be used for performance, stress, and vibration studies of helicopters and VTOL aircraft; applications are given for helicopter in flight regime from 80 to 160 knots; sample problem is carried out at 150 knots; rapidly convergent iterative procedure, which takes into account blade stall, is used to put rotor in trim; blade elemental lifts and drags are computed using wind tunnel airfoil data; rotor blade dynamics are determined using set of complex equations based upon extension of N.O.Myklestad's analysis for rotating beams.
Analysis of helicopter aeroelastic characteristics in high-speed flight
